A lively italic serif with bracketed, wedge-like serifs and a calligraphic stroke flow. The forms show a clear slant and a gently modulated stroke, with rounded joins and slightly tapered terminals that keep the texture soft rather than sharp. Proportions feel traditional and text-oriented: capitals are sturdy and slightly condensed, while lowercase letters show varied widths and a natural, handwritten rhythm. Numerals follow the same inclined, serifed construction, matching the overall color and cadence in running text.

Well suited to long-form editorial settings where an italic voice is needed for emphasis, introductions, and quotations, as well as for magazine features and cultural journalism. The strong, readable silhouettes also make it effective for headings, standfirsts, and pull quotes where a traditional serif italic can add pace and character.

The font conveys a classic, bookish tone with a warm, human presence. Its energetic italic movement and subtly irregular, hand-influenced detailing add personality without becoming informal, suggesting a confident, editorial voice rather than a purely mechanical one.

The design appears intended as a conventional, readable serif italic with a humanist, calligraphic underpinning—aimed at providing a warm, authoritative companion for text typography while retaining enough energy to stand on its own in display roles.

Counters are open and the spacing appears balanced for continuous reading, producing an even gray value despite the lively forms. The lowercase shows pronounced movement in letters like a, e, and s, and the overall rhythm feels slightly bouncy, which helps headings and pull quotes feel animated while remaining conventional.
